    Computer Crashes/Blue Screen when Playing games and Videos

    I recently installed some new Ram and graphics card in my computer and after that my computer is crashing and going to the blue screen whenever I am playing video games or watching videos. Below is the error that is coming in blue screen:

    Driver_IRQL_NOT_LESS_OR_EQUAL

    STOP: 0x000000D1 (0x00001000,0x0000000A,0x00000001,0xAA68408B

    nvarm.sys - Address AA68408B
    Base at AA67F000
    Datestamp 70b3cf78

    Any help would be appreciated. Thanks

    Re: Computer Crashes/Blue Screen when Playing games and Videos

    You are getting nvram.sys that is a part of your graphics drivers. So, have you tried to install the drivers supplied with the video card that you have installed. You should not rely on Windows default drivers or use Windows update for drivers.
